Disney, WarnerMedia, NBCUniversal and to a lesser degree ViacomCBS have all undergone management overhauls during the past 18 months.
Disney and NBCUniversal broke dramatically with long-standing tradition and reorganized TV and streaming operations to separate the functions of content creation and distribution.
WarnerMedia moved to integrate Warner Bros., HBO and Turner more closely than ever before. All of these moves have had the effect of centralizing programming and development operations.
